忽略UseLegacySql = FALSE,BigRQuery

时间:2017-09-20 08:19:59

标签: r google-bigquery bigrquery

我遇到一些问题,BigRQuery无法识别useLegacySql=false函数中的query_exec()参数。

我的通话看起来像query_exec(query, project = project, useLegacySql = FALSE, max_pages = Inf)

我有几个问题:

1)通过传递" #standardSQL ..."来尝试解决方法时在查询中我得到错误

  

错误:1.979 - 1.979:未找到查询

2)当我通过useLegacySql = false时,我得到了:

  

错误:1.1 - 1.966:无法识别的令牌UNION。 [尝试使用标准SQL ....]

3)我也用use_Legacy_Sql = false尝试了同样的错误:

  

错误:1.1 - 1.966:无法识别的令牌UNION。 [尝试使用标准SQL ....]

这是一个错误吗?

1 个答案:

答案 0 :(得分:2)

如您的问题所示,您仍然没有使用输入:

query_exec(query,
           project,
           ...,
           use_legacy_sql = FALSE)

您使用use_Legacy_Sql代替use_legacy_sql,我想知道这是否有所作为。